Person Struck and Killed by Train Wednesday Morning in Downtown Antioch

by ECT

Just after 8:00 am Wednesday, Antioch Police and Contra Costa County Fire responded to a report of a person who was struck by a freight train in the 100 block of I Street.  The person was deceased on scene.

IMG_7330According to Burlington Northern Santa Fe, the freight train could not avoid the person who moved in front of the train as it approached.

The incident stopped all train traffic on the tracks in both directions while shutting down a portion of I Street and Waldie Plaza as police and BNSF investigated the incident near the AMTRAK station.

In a statement by Lena Kent, spokesperson for BNSF, she the incident is still under investigation and they are unable to confirm if this was an accident or a suicide.

Although local residents said they know the victim, police or BNSF have not released any information about the victim or their identity.

The Antioch Police Department referred all questions on this investigation to BNSF as they have jurisdiction along the railroad tracks.
